Are you interested in serving as a Director on the A.R.T. Board or volunteering on a committee? Join us for an Info Session on Monday, April 27, 2026, at 12:00 PM via Zoom to learn how you can get involved and what being on the Board of Directors entails.


Our current Board of Directors will be available to answer questions regarding these upcoming open positions:

  • Vice President (1-Year Interim Term)
  • Secretary (2-Year Term)
  • Director of Communications (2-Year Term)

  • Director of Development (2-Year Term)
  • Director of Membership (2-Year Term)
  • Director of Outreach (2-Year Term)
  • Director of the Publications (2-Year Term)

Serving on the A.R.T. Board is a unique volunteer opportunity that goes beyond the boundaries of your current professional commitments. As an A.R.T. Board member, you'll have the chance to develop valuable skills in local leadership, project management, and networking. Most importantly, you'll act as a representative for your colleagues and all A.R.T. members.
